Taj Bhutta is the Career Officer for schools and colleges at the Institute of Physics. He manages various projects that promote the benefits of studying physics Post-16. Recent projects include developing extra-curricula activities in association with CRAC and the introduction of a new membership category for 16-19 year olds. Before joining the Institute in 2008, Taj studied for his PhD in laser physics at The University of Southampton and worked as an A-level Physics teacher in London.
